Alexandra O Pena
Washington, DC- 4941 Tilden St NW, Washington, DC 20016
More about Alexandra O Pena
Summary
- Full Name
- Alexandra O Pena
- Used to Live in:
-
- Store manager
Phones and Addresses
-
Washington, DC4941 Tilden St Nw Washington, DC 20016